Visitor handling at the front desk — Brindlewood Labs, Harper Quay site. Every visitor must sign in on the lobby tablet, receive a red lanyard, and be collected in person by their host; visitors are never sent up unaccompanied. Keep the visitor log open during busy periods and reconcile badges at the end of each day. Deliveries go to the loading bay, not reception. To release the inner lobby doors for an escorted visitor, enter the code printed below.

door code, kajop-bawip: bdg-HG-9

## Who to ping about GiftNote

Welcome aboard! GiftNote is our donation-receipt mailer for the Larchfield Fund. Template tweaks go to the comms folks; delivery failures and bounce weirdness go to the platform crew. Don't push template changes on Fridays — receipts batch over the weekend. For anything GiftNote-related, start with the address below.

billing contact of kaweg-tajeg = drudor.lamion.oliath@torvalabs.test

Audit item 14 — leaked file descriptor hunt in the Brindlemoor ingest service. Confirm that the lsof snapshots captured before and after the 72-hour soak show a stable descriptor count, and that the patched socket-close path in the retry handler is covered by the new regression test. Attach the soak report to the release ticket. Final verification of this item is owned by:

approver of bagug-bagag = Holael Pramir